Description: Plasma Mobile is a free and open source mobile operating system built using KDE technologies. It offers a full-featured graphical user interface and application ecosystem for mobile devices, with a focus on customization and user freedom.

Description: JingOS is a Linux distribution designed specifically for tablets and touchscreen devices. It features an intuitive interface optimized for touch input and gestures, making it easy to navigate and use on tablets. The interface has large icons, widgets, and an app launcher for quickly accessing apps.

Key Features Comparison

Plasma Mobile
Plasma Mobile Features
  • Plasma Mobile shell optimized for touchscreens
  • Wayland display server for smooth graphics
  • KDE Frameworks and Qt for responsive apps
  • Seamless integration with Linux desktop environments
  • Supports Android hardware and applications
  • Customizable user interface and theming
  • Privacy and security focused
JingOS
JingOS Features
  • Touch-optimized interface
  • Gesture navigation
  • Widget-based home screen
  • App launcher
  • Sidebar for quick settings
  • Multi-window support
  • Designed for tablets and 2-in-1 devices
